Meghan McCain, daughter of Sen. John McCain (R-Ariz.), had some choice words Wednesday for Minnesota GOP Rep. Michelle Bachmann's secondary, Tea Party-sponsored State of the Union rebuttal, calling it the action of a "rogue," "poor man's Sarah Palin."

"I think it's important to note that Michele Bachmann is not a leader, and she's not the leader of the Repbulican Party," McCain noted, walking a similar line to that given by GOP leadership before Bachmann's address.

"Michele Bachmann is no better than a poor man's Sarah Palin," she added.

McCain then turned on her internal media critic.

"I think CNN should be ashamed of themselves for airing this," McCain said, after commending MSNBC and Fox News for choosing not to run the Bachmann's response. "It is one rogue woman who couldn't even look into the camera directly."

Even Senior White House Advisor David Axelrod took a dig at Bachmann for the same detail following the speech on Tuesday night.
